VERONA, Wis. — The Verona Police Department says it is investigating after a trailer was stolen from a construction site earlier this week, and they’re asking for your help in tracking it down.
According to police, an 8′ x 12′ K&K Manufacturing trailer was towed away by a single-cab pickup truck sometime between 3:45 p.m. and 4 p.m. on Sunday, Jan. 15. Security cameras in the neighborhood were able to capture some images of the suspected thief’s truck as it left the 400 block of Robin Hill Road.
“We realize the pictures of the suspect vehicle are not great; however, after a canvas of the neighborhood, they are the only images we have at this time,” Verona Police Lt. Dustin Fehrmann said in a public statement.
The stolen trailer is black and had dual axels with white rims and a single rear door in the center of the trailer. There were no markings on the outside of the trailer other than the manufacturer’s label on the trailer tongue. Police say the trailer was full of construction equipment.
Police believe the truck captured in the security footage drove west on Robin Hill Road before going south on Hemlock Drive, then west on Lone Pine Way while leaving the neighborhood.
